Name and origin of the protein
Protein name Activin receptor type-1B [Precursor]
Synonyms EC 2.7.11.30
ACTR-IB
Serine/threonine-protein kinase receptor R2
SKR2
Gene name
Name: Acvr1b
Synonyms: Acvrlk4
From
Rattus norvegicus (Rat) [TaxID: 10116] 
Taxonomy Eukaryota; Metazoa; Chordata; Craniata; Vertebrata; Euteleostomi; Mammalia; Eutheria; Euarchontoglires; Glires; Rodentia; Sciurognathi; Muroidea; Muridae; Murinae; Rattus.
Protein existence 2: Evidence at transcript level;

Features
SEVIEWER logo Feature table viewer FT aligner logo Feature aligner
KeyFrom   To Length Description FTId
SIGNAL   1    23  23     Potential. 
CHAIN   24   505  482     Activin receptor type-1B. PRO_0000024419
TOPO_DOM   24   126  103     Extracellular (Potential). 
TRANSMEM   127   149  23     Potential. 
TOPO_DOM   150   505  356     Cytoplasmic (Potential). 
DOMAIN   177   206  30     GS. 
DOMAIN   207   497  291     Protein kinase. 
NP_BIND   213   221  9     ATP (By similarity). 
ACT_SITE   335   335        Proton acceptor (By similarity). 
BINDING   234   234        ATP (By similarity). 
MOD_RES   380   380        Phosphotyrosine (By similarity). 
CARBOHYD   43    43        N-linked (GlcNAc...) (Potential).
